CULLODEN POINT PRESERVE This park is named after the HMS Culloden, a British 74-gun, 170-ft warship that sank in 1781 about 200 yards from shore, where it still rests. A well-marked trail that takes about 2 hours to loop (a mile or less to the shoreline) leads from the parking area off Flamingo Avenue to a picturesque rocky beach on Fort Pond Bay. The trailhead is next to a small plaque commemorating the shipwreck. The natural wooded area and shoreline has seen little change from the days when the Montauketts lived here in a world of hidden ponds, specimen trees, wetlands and beautiful shoreline. Great views of the bluffs at Culloden Point.

Today’s Second House has stood at the western edge of our hamlet since 1797, welcoming visitors to Montauk. Over the years it endured multiple additions, renovations and embellishments until, in around 1912, it was transformed into the sprawling summer cottage that most of us associated with our first glimpse of town as we drove in from the West.
